We walk through the full coaching workflow, starting with ball flight because the ball doesn’t lie. Attack angle, club path, face-to-path, and dynamic lie frame the story of what happened at impact. Then we connect movement to outcome with 3D: sways, tilts, rotations, and sequencing show how the body sets up the result. Finally, force plates explain why the shot turned out that way. Two non-negotiables lead the improvement curve—pressure under the balls of both feet with a positive in-to-out pressure line at setup, and a timely pressure transfer of at least 75 percent into the trail side by lead-arm parallel. Hit those benchmarks and you’ll see faster club speed, cleaner contact, and calmer curvature.

You’ll also hear a real case study: a solid player with four inches of sway and late trail-side loading. In one session, we reshaped his pressure map, trimmed the sway to an inch, and lifted trail-side load to 85 percent on time. Launch numbers stabilized, the face behaved, and the shot pattern tightened. That’s the power of combining launch monitor data, Sportsbox 3D, and Smart2Move force plates—objective inputs that turn “feel” into a repeatable fix. We’re not chasing pretty positions; we’re building patterns that hold up on the course.
